Runbook: Scanline barcode bridge

If warehouse scans stop flowing into Cartwheel, it's almost always the bridge service on the Dunmore floor box wedging after a USB hiccup. Bounce the service first — nine times out of ten that fixes it. If not, check the queue depth before escalating. When restarting, make sure the bridge comes up with these settings.

deployment values, yafop-bajef:
[gilok]
team = ulaius
access_code = ac_423664
host = gilok.sivrelhq.corp
port = 9200
owner = pelius.istax
peer = eliok.torvasoft.internal

# Skevio Diagram Editor — Undo/Redo Limits

Heads up, reviewer: undo history in Skevio isn't unbounded, and that's deliberate. Each open canvas keeps a ring buffer of operations, and big diagrams with image nodes can chew memory fast, so we cap both entry count and total payload size. Redo stacks are cleared on any new edit, standard stuff. If a change touches these paths, double-check snapshot coalescing too. The caps currently enforced in the editor core are as follows.

limits module of kawef-hawef:
TIERS = {
    "belax": 967,
    "gorvan": 210,
    "ulair": 473,
}

Handover: validator plugin system (Copperline)

Welcome aboard. The Copperline validator framework loads plugins from the registry at startup; each plugin declares a schema version and a priority. Failing plugins are skipped, not fatal, so check the loader logs if a validator seems ignored. I've left the contract tests in the shared suite — run them before merging any new plugin. One last thing: the plugin signing keystore is sealed between releases, and to unseal it you'll need the recovery passphrase below.

vault phrase of taweg-kafof = oliax-zorael